برنامه‌نویسی بر پایه پیش‌نمونه

از ویکی‌پدیا، دانشنامهٔ آزاد

نسخه‌ای که می‌بینید، نسخهٔ فعلی این صفحه است که توسط Dexbot (بحث | مشارکت‌ها) در تاریخ ‏۱۳ آوریل ۲۰۲۱، ساعت ۱۸:۳۴ ویرایش شده است. آدرس فعلی این صفحه، پیوند دائمی این نسخه را نشان می‌دهد.

(تفاوت) → نسخهٔ قدیمی‌تر | نمایش نسخهٔ فعلی (تفاوت) | نسخهٔ جدیدتر ← (تفاوت)

برنامه‌نویسی بر پایه پیش‌نمونه (به انگلیسی: Prototype-based programming) شیوه‌ای از برنامه‌نویسی شئ‌گرا است که کلاس در آن موجود نیست و رفتار استفادهٔ مجدد (که به وراثت در زبان‌های بر پایهٔ کلاس شناخته می‌شود) توسط فرایندی از شبیه‌سازی اشیاء موجود انجام می‌پذیرد. این مدل همچنین به بدون کلاس، پیش‌نمونه‌گرا یا برنامه‌نویسی بر پایهٔ نمونه نیز شناخته می‌شود. دلگیشن (به انگلیسی: Delegation) قابلیت زبانی است که برنامه‌نویسی بر پایهٔ پیش‌نمونه را پیشتیبانی می‌کند.[۱]


به عنوان نمونه می شود به زبان های برنامه نویسی جاوا اسکریپت یا پایتون اشاره کرد.

منابع[ویرایش]

  1. Wikipedia contributors, "Prototype-based programming," Wikipedia, The Free Encyclopedia, http://en.wikipedia.org/w/index.php?title=Prototype-based_programming&oldid=439947224 (accessed July 21, 2011).